The SOSTAC Framework as a Planning Model

To create a successful digital transformation plan, businesses can adopt established strategic models like SOSTAC. Originally developed for marketing strategy, SOSTAC has become widely recognized for its applicability in various business planning scenarios. The acronym stands for Situation, Objectives, Strategy, Tactics, Action, and Control. Each step of the framework supports organizations in making informed decisions and executing digital initiatives effectively.

The model provides a structured method to understand current capabilities, set clear goals, design strategic pathways, and implement solutions while continuously measuring performance. By using this model, companies can avoid the pitfalls of reactive or fragmented transformation and instead pursue a deliberate and data-driven approach.

Objectives: Setting Clear and Measurable Goals

Once the current situation is understood, the next step is to define objectives. These goals should be aligned with the company’s overall business strategy and reflect what the digital transformation is meant to achieve. Objectives might include reducing operational costs, improving customer satisfaction, increasing revenue, or enhancing data security.

To ensure success, objectives must be specific, measurable, achievable, relevant, and time-bound. For instance, a company might set an objective to automate 60 percent of its invoice processing within 12 months. Clear objectives help focus resources, provide benchmarks for progress, and maintain alignment across teams and departments.

Building Cross-Functional Implementation Teams

Implementation efforts require collaboration across departments. Cross-functional teams ensure that all business perspectives are represented, from technology and finance to operations and customer support. These teams are responsible for translating strategy into tactical execution and solving cross-departmental challenges as they arise.

Each team should include process owners, technical specialists, and transformation champions. Process owners provide subject matter expertise and ensure that redesign efforts meet real-world needs. Technical specialists are responsible for systems integration, data migration, and software configuration. Transformation champions act as communication bridges and help drive cultural adoption within their departments.

The success of these teams depends on clear roles, open communication, and visible support from leadership. Regular progress reviews, shared objectives, and accountability frameworks help keep initiatives on track.

Leveraging Automation to Improve Efficiency

Automation plays a significant role in digital transformation implementation. Automating repetitive and rule-based tasks allows companies to reduce errors, lower costs, and increase speed. Examples include invoice processing, employee onboarding, customer support, and inventory management.

Automation not only improves operational efficiency but also frees employees to focus on more strategic work. This shift from transactional to analytical or creative tasks boosts engagement and adds greater value to the organization.

Businesses must take care to align automation initiatives with process improvements. Automating a flawed process simply replicates inefficiency at scale. Therefore, process redesign often precedes or accompanies automation to ensure optimal outcomes.

The Shift from Manual to Automated Procurement

In many businesses, procurement begins with a paper request, followed by a series of emails, spreadsheets, and phone calls. Manual data entry, physical approvals, and reactive ordering are the norm. These methods not only consume time but also obscure visibility, invite errors, and hinder collaboration.

Digital procurement platforms transform this process into a streamlined, automated workflow. Employees submit purchase requests online, which follow pre-defined approval paths. Orders are automatically checked against budgets, supplier catalogs, and compliance policies. Once approved, purchase orders are generated and dispatched digitally. Invoices are matched to orders and receipts, and payments are scheduled accordingly.

This touchless workflow reduces manual intervention, speeds up processing, and enforces controls. Every transaction is tracked, time-stamped, and auditable, enabling accountability and governance at every stage.

Creating a Guided Buying Experience

One of the most impactful changes brought by digital procurement is the introduction of guided buying. This concept simplifies purchasing by giving users a curated interface with pre-approved suppliers, standardized catalogs, and rule-based automation.

Employees no longer need to search for vendors or negotiate terms. They are guided toward preferred options based on category, budget, and policy. This not only improves compliance and speeds up procurement but also reduces maverick spend and ensures better pricing through consolidated buying power.

Guided buying creates consistency across departments, regardless of geography or function. It also improves the employee experience, making procurement faster, easier, and more transparent.

Integrating Procurement with Other Business Systems

Digital procurement systems do not operate in isolation. They are designed to integrate seamlessly with core enterprise applications such as accounting, enterprise resource planning, inventory management, and contract lifecycle management.

This integration creates end-to-end visibility and control. For example, a requisition approved in procurement automatically updates budget availability in finance. A purchase receipt triggers an inventory update. A delayed shipment may flag a potential production bottleneck.

Interconnected systems reduce duplication of effort, eliminate manual data transfer, and provide holistic insight into business operations. This enhances strategic agility and supports coordinated decision-making across departments.

Automating the Procure-to-Pay Process

The procure-to-pay (P2P) process encompasses the entire procurement cycle from purchase request to payment settlement. Automating this process delivers a wide range of benefits. Cycle times shrink, human error is reduced, and cost savings are realized through better contract compliance and captured discounts.

Automation also improves compliance by enforcing pre-defined workflows. For instance, all purchases above a certain threshold require dual approval. All invoices must match a purchase order and receipt before payment is released. These rules are embedded into the system, reducing the risk of fraud and regulatory violations.

Automation liberates employees from low-value tasks such as data entry, document routing, and payment tracking. Instead, they can focus on supplier negotiation, process improvement, and analytics.
